Abstract
The present invention relates to a kind of planetary gear system and wrist-watch.A kind of planetary gear system, the first tooth axle and the first tooth axle the hour disk being fixedly linked being fixedly linked including the former hour wheel driven by basic movement and the former hour wheel and the minute system being fixedly mounted on the hour disk, the hour disk directly obtains power and with the first tooth axle as axle center and the former hour wheel synchronous rotation by the first tooth axle from former hour wheel, and the minute system is the synchronous revolution in axle center with the first tooth axle under the drive of the hour disk rotation.The planetary gear system and wrist-watch outward appearance that the present invention is provided are unique, and hour disk, the minute disk rotating function not available for conventional wristwatch are realized by exquisite design, more attractive to consumer compared to conventional wristwatch;Accurately clocking capability is still maintained simultaneously and facilitates user's read access time function, make also to have preferable utility function concurrently while the great sight of the present invention, novelty.

Specific embodiment
In order to make the purpose , technical scheme and advantage of the present invention be clearer, it is right below in conjunction with drawings and Examples
The present invention is further elaborated.It should be appreciated that the specific embodiments described herein are merely illustrative of the present invention, and
It is not used in the restriction present invention.
As shown in figure 1, the embodiment of the present invention provides a kind of planetary gear system, whole system be arranged in wristwatch case and
Driven as motive power by basic movement, the system includes hour disk 1 and minute disk 2, under the driving of the planetary gear system,
Wrist-watch can realize three kinds of motions effect:1st, hour disk circles for 1 every 12 hour certainly clockwise;Can be displayed for a user by this effect
Time is accurate to hour, and shows the time by card rotation, display mode of indicators turn motionless compared to traditional card
With more novelty and stylishness;2nd, 2 every 12 hours public affairs clockwise of minute disk are filled one week, without rotation;Minute disk 2 is over time
Passage is moved along dial plate;3rd, the minute hand in minute disk 2 circles certainly per hour, for being accurate to the time of display for client
Minute.
Specifically, when the planetary gear system in the present embodiment includes that engagement is connected to the former hour wheel 3 and original of basic movement
The hour dish axle set and hour dish axle set that the first tooth axle 11 and the first tooth axle 11 that wheel 3 is fixedly linked are fixedly linked pass through screw thread
The hour disk 1 being fixedly linked.Former hour wheel 3 drives every 12 hours clockwise from circling by basic movement, and hour disk 1 passes through first
Tooth axle 11 obtains power from former hour wheel 3, realizes circling certainly clockwise for 12 hours with the synchronous axial system of former hour wheel 3.By in hour
Clock hands are portrayed on disk 1, the marking hour hands scale on the watchcase of the surrounding of hour disk 1 can make wrist-watch realize hour clocking capability;
Further, since being to realize timing by the unitary rotation of hour disk 1, compared to traditional pointer timing there is unique vision to imitate
Really, the various spies such as sunset sunrise, sun, the moon and the stars change can be realized with the passage of time by portraying various patterns on hour disk 1
Special effect really, gives user a kind of brand-new wrist-watch experience.
The attached hour wheel 4 with the synchronous axial system of former hour wheel 3 is additionally provided with the first tooth axle 11 between hour disk 1 and former hour wheel 3, it is attached
Hour wheel 4 is pressed together in former hour wheel 3, can be also integrally formed with hour dish axle set, makes hour disk 1 and former both hour wheels 3 associated movement.
As illustrated, the present embodiment is provided with the second tooth axle 12 for being fixed on casing in the side of attached hour wheel 4, the second tooth axle 12 covers from bottom to up
Be provided with no-load voltage ratio one wheel 5 and no-load voltage ratio two wheel 6, no-load voltage ratio one wheel 5 with no-load voltage ratio two wheel 6 press, the two associated movement, and no-load voltage ratio one wheel 5 with
The engagement of attached hour wheel 4 is connected.Sun tooth axle sleeve 7 and and the sun are also arranged with the first tooth axle 11 between hour disk 1 and attached hour wheel 4
The sun gear piece 8 that tooth axle sleeve 7 is connected as a single entity, sun tooth axle sleeve 7 engages 8 turns of the drive sun gear piece that is connected by taking turns 6 with no-load voltage ratio two
It is dynamic.Sun tooth axle sleeve 7 and the gap of the first tooth axle 11 coordinate, so that can produce relative rotation between the two.Sun gear piece 8 passes through
It is capable of achieving to circle certainly clockwise for every 6 hours after the transmission of series of gears and no-load voltage ratio effect.It is provided with point in the side of sun gear piece 8
Master slave system, this minute system includes that minute hand 13, minute hand tooth axle 14, minute hand tooth axle sleeve 15, minute dish axle cover 16 and minute disk 2,
Wherein minute hand 13 is arranged on the top of minute hand tooth axle 14, and minute hand tooth axle sleeve 15 is arranged on the bottom of minute hand tooth axle 14, and minute hand 13, minute hand
Tooth axle 14, minute hand tooth axle sleeve 15 are the structure of pressing one.Minute hand tooth is available in hour disk 1 and offering respectively for minute disk 2
First through hole and the second through hole that axle 14 is passed through, minute hand tooth axle 14 sequentially pass through first through hole and the second through hole from bottom to up, i.e.,
Minute disk 2 is arranged on the upside of hour disk 1, and minute hand 13 is arranged on the upside of minute disk 2.Minute dish axle set 16 is sleeved on minute hand tooth axle 14
Above and with the gap of minute hand tooth axle 14 coordinate, so that it can produce relative rotation between minute hand tooth axle 14;Minute dish axle set 16
Upper end is also fitted close with the through hole on minute disk 2 and is connected, and can drive the synchronous axial system of minute disk 2;Under minute dish axle set 16
End is connected as a single entity with planetary gear piece 9 and planetary gear piece 9 is engaged with sun gear piece 8 and is connected, so that sun gear piece 8 can pass through planet
Wheel piece 9, minute dish axle set 16 drive minute disk 2 to rotate;The middle-end of minute dish axle set 16 is located in the first through hole of hour disk 1,
And be fixedly linked with first through hole by seal, because minute hand tooth axle 14 is not fixedly connected with watchcase, therefore, hour disk 1
Whole minute system will be driven with the first tooth axle 11 for axle center synchronous axial system during rotation.In order that minute hand 13 is realized rotating timing work(
Can, the present embodiment is provided with the center minute wheel piece 17 being meshed with minute hand tooth axle 14, center minute wheel in the watchcase of the downside of hour disk 1
Piece 17 is fixed on movement clamping plate, relative to watchcase referential without relative motion, when minute system is whole under the drive of hour disk 1
During rotation, center minute wheel piece 17 is maintained static, and realizes rotation under the stirring of minute hand tooth Zhou14 centers minute wheels piece 17, and then drive
The rotation of minute hand 13 being connected with minute hand tooth axle 14, draws time scale, you can realize minute hand timing work(by the subscript of minute disk 2
Energy.It is that achievable hour disk circles for every 12 hours certainly clockwise, minute hand disk revolves round the sun for every 12 hours clockwise by arrangement above
One week, every 12 hours public affairs clockwise of minute hand circle and one Wednesday of rotation kind movement effects clockwise of each hour.
The present embodiment to implement process as follows:Basic movement positioned at watchcase bottom drives former hour wheel 3 every 12 hours
Clockwise from circling, former hour wheel 3 and then drive attached hour wheel 4 and the synchronous axial system of hour disk 1, realize hour disk 1 every 12 hour from
Circle, the hour clocking capability that time scale is achievable the present embodiment is drawn by the watchcase subscript of the surrounding of hour disk 1.Point
Master slave system 16 is fixedly linked due to being covered by minute dish axle with hour disk 1, with the rotation of hour disk 1 integrally will passively follow it is small
When disk 1 revolved round the sun around the first tooth axle 11, if minute disk 2 without other relatively rotate, in the minutes scale that the surface of minute disk 2 is portrayed
Also can concomitant rotation, this kind of situation will necessarily cause user's read access time calibration data difficult and confusing, have influence on user's reading
The efficiency and accuracy of time are taken, therefore, the present embodiment also revolved round the sun with it in opposite direction with another kind for minute disk 2 is provided with
Relatively rotate, rotated with neutralizing dial plate that its on business turns to cause, specifically, the attached hour wheel 4 coaxial with former hour wheel 3 is same every 12 small
When from circling, by the no-load voltage ratio one engage with attached hour wheel 4 take turns 5 and no-load voltage ratio one take turns no-load voltage ratio two wheel 6 and the no-load voltage ratio of 5 synchronous axial systems
What the sun tooth axle sleeve 7 of the engagement of two wheel 6 was engaged with the sun gear piece 8 of the synchronous axial system of sun tooth axle sleeve 7 and with sun gear piece 8
Planetary gear piece 9 and then drive with the minute disk 2 of the synchronous axial system of planetary gear piece 9 around the rotation of minute hand tooth axle 14, by setting each gear
Between gear ratio, you can realize minute disk 2 revolution while by rotation offset minute disk 2 card rotation, realize point
The scale portrayed on clock dial 2 is remained stablizes constant, so as to facilitate user to read the minute hand time.In the present embodiment, attached hour wheel 4
Using the gear (Z represents the number of teeth) of Z48, the wheel of no-load voltage ratio one 5 uses the gear of Z18, the wheel of no-load voltage ratio two 6 to use the gears of Z27, sun tooth
Axle sleeve 7 uses the gear of Z36, sun gear piece 8 to use the gear of Z60, and planetary gear piece 9 uses the gear of Z60, so as to realize the sun
Clockwise from circling, 2 every 12 hours public affairs of minute disk do not produce rotation to wheel piece on the basis of circling, realize both new within 8 every 6 hours
Grain husk and the outward appearance of practicality and function manifestation mode.Center minute wheel piece 17 is maintained static, and minute hand tooth Zhou14Yu centers minute wheels piece 17 is nibbled
Close, rotation will be realized under the stirring of center minute wheel piece 17 during minute hand tooth axle 14 revolves round the sun around the first tooth axle 11,
Minute hand 13 and the synchronous axial system of minute hand tooth axle 14, center minute wheel piece 17 uses the gear of Z99, minute hand tooth axle 14 to use in the present embodiment
The gear of Z9, finally realizes that minute hand 13, per hour from circling, by the cooperation with minute disk 2, is capable of achieving to be accurate to minute
Time showing.
